mirror of
https://github.com/Security-Onion-Solutions/securityonion.git
synced 2025-12-06 09:12:45 +01:00
Fix error message printing in so-rule
This commit is contained in:
@@ -80,7 +80,10 @@ def find_minion_pillar() -> str:
|
|||||||
print_err('Could not find manager-type pillar (eval, standalone, manager, managersearch, import). Are you running this script on the manager?')
|
print_err('Could not find manager-type pillar (eval, standalone, manager, managersearch, import). Are you running this script on the manager?')
|
||||||
sys.exit(3)
|
sys.exit(3)
|
||||||
elif len(result) > 1:
|
elif len(result) > 1:
|
||||||
res_str = ', '.join(f'\"{result}\"')
|
res_arr = []
|
||||||
|
for r in result:
|
||||||
|
res_arr.append(f'\"{r}\"')
|
||||||
|
res_str = ', '.join(res_arr)
|
||||||
print_err('(This should not happen, the system is in an error state if you see this message.)\n')
|
print_err('(This should not happen, the system is in an error state if you see this message.)\n')
|
||||||
print_err('More than one manager-type pillar exists, minion id\'s listed below:')
|
print_err('More than one manager-type pillar exists, minion id\'s listed below:')
|
||||||
print_err(f' {res_str}')
|
print_err(f' {res_str}')
|
||||||
|
|||||||
Reference in New Issue
Block a user